Annonces Google
Serveur IRC
Serveur : irc.portlane.se
Canal : #AmigaNG
Activité du Site

Pages vues depuis 25/07/2007 : 25 172 845

  • Nb. de membres 187
  • Nb. d'articles 1 270
  • Nb. de forums 19
  • Nb. de sujets 20
  • Nb. de critiques 24

Top 10  Statistiques

Index du forum »»  Création-Développement »» Démo Thank You en Hollywood

Démo Thank You en Hollywood#2333

5Contributeur(s)
K-Lzzd10hsinisrusartblinkElwood
3 Modérateur(s)
K-LElwoodcorto
sinisrus sinisrusicon_post
Merci je vais garder ça comme références :-)
 Et pour les fonctions tu dis qu'il vaut mieux utiliser des variable plutôt que des arguments?!

Donc

Bob ="toto"

Fonction test()
Debugprint(bob)
Endfunction

Plutôt que faire fonction test(bob)...

Mais si c'est ça c'est des variable globale alors que les locale sont plus rapide :-/

Message édité par : sinisrus / 19-08-2016 01:51
Message édité par : sinisrus / 19-08-2016 01:58
artblink artblinkicon_post
ou :

Bob[0]="Toto"

Fonction test()
Debugprint(bob[0])
Endfunction

Pareil, on nomme JAMAIS les index d'une table... ça ralenti les tables :

bob["Valeur"]="Toto" (NON)
Bob[0]="Toto"

On initialise TOUJOURS une table avant de l'utilisé

Bob={} ; ma table doit contenir 10 lignes (faut penser Excel)
For local Compteur=0 to 9
Bob[Compteur]=0
Next

Les 10 zones sont initialisé et repéré, les accès a cette table seront largement plus rapide ;-)
Bon ça vaut pas le coup pour des petites tables, mais c'est important par exemple pour des coordonnées d'un objet 3D qui peut contenir des centaines de données, voir des miliers

Voilà ;-)
Petites Annonces

0 annonce(s) publiée(s)

Consulter

AmigaOS 4.1

Laissez-vous tenter par
AmigaOS 4.1
AmiTheme

AmiTheme